Thunderous Opening Across Markets
Released in over 4,200 screens globally, Kesari Chapter 2 has made an immediate impact. The film grossed around ₹12 crore from the domestic market and an impressive ₹3 crore from overseas territories including the UAE, USA, Canada, UK, and Australia.
The film performed exceptionally well in northern states like Punjab, Delhi-NCR, and Uttar Pradesh, where the themes of valor and patriotism deeply resonate with the audience. Southern states like Tamil Nadu and Kerala also saw decent footfalls, primarily due to Madhavan’s strong fan base.
Advance bookings in metro cities like Mumbai, Bengaluru, and Hyderabad were nearly houseful for evening and night shows, indicating strong urban appeal.

Box Office Clash: Kesari Chapter 2 vs Jaat
The highly discussed box office clash between Kesari Chapter 2 and Jaat ended in favor of the former, as it outshone Jaat in both critical and commercial terms. While Jaat targeted regional circuits and leaned into folk storytelling, it couldn’t match the scale or promotional reach of Kesari Chapter 2.
According to Box Office India, Kesari Chapter 2 took a commanding 65% market share on Day 1 between both films. Its performance was particularly dominant in multiplexes, while Jaat saw better performance in a few single screens in Haryana and Rajasthan.

What Lies Ahead?
Industry insiders expect the film to hit ₹50-55 crore globally by the end of its opening weekend. With no major Bollywood releases lined up in the next 7 days, Kesari Chapter 2 is expected to hold strong in the coming week.
The film is also performing well in overseas markets, where the Indian diaspora has shown strong support. International distributors have increased screen counts due to positive word-of-mouth, especially in Canada, UAE, and Australia.
Trade experts have also hinted at possible award nominations and an extended theatrical run, with some speculating that Kesari Chapter 2 could reach the ₹150 crore mark if current trends hold.
